This was great for our family of aging rock fans, and their teenage kids. Both the cafe and adjacent Hard Rock vault have incredible rock artifacts, instruments, and photos. When we arrived there was no line to skip, but within an hour there was a long queue. If you like lots of American style cafe food, you'll love the lunch. We'd prefer something smaller and lighter. The separate, unrelated "Rock Legends and Beatles Tour" which you can order through Viator picks up nearby, so consider combining both, as we did. It worked out great.

Great timing on our part meant that we only had to wait about 15 minutes to be seated. This is a small cafe, and if you want to take advantage of the prebooked, skip the line aspect, be realistic about allowing enough time to arrive semi-hungry and anticipate a wait. The meal was very good and service courteous and accommodating. We enjoyed our meal as we watched the line outside get longer and longer. The tour of the vault was a like a trip through rock & roll history.
